    This book addresses for the first time the theme of the history of art in Mexico and in the United States. A very interesting approach of the history and in particular the foundations of American culture, as well as the development of art in two neighboring countries, highlighting why art in the United States developed at the end of the 17th century, while in Mexico art began after the Conquest in the second half of the 16th century
